    Abstract:

    There is a good property of topology conjugated between the dynamics system and the symbolic dynamics. In this paper, dynamic frame partition method, which is used to transform the time series of the dynamical system into the symbolic time series, is proposed. We compute the LempelZiv complexity value of the symbolic series. And then the intrinsic complexity of the system can be made qualitative analysis. At last, a numerical simulation result indicates that the proposed method can describe the complexity of the dynamics system and can qualitatively estimate the property of the system.
